Walter Clyde Cathcart 1941 - 1987

Walter Clyde Cathcart was born on September 26, 1941, and died at age 45 years old on August 23, 1987. Walter Cathcart was buried at Massachusetts National Cemetery Section 14A Site 261 Off Connery Avenue, in Bourne, Ma. In 1941, in the year that Walter Clyde Cathcart was born, on June 25th, President Roosevelt signed Executive Order 8802, prohibiting racial discrimination in the defense industry. EO 8802 was the first federal action to prohibit employment discrimination - without prejudice as to "race, creed, color, or national origin" - in the U.S. Civil Rights groups had planned a march on Washington D.C. to protest for equal rights but with the signing of the Order, they canceled the March.
